How do I choose a crypto trading bot?
When it comes to selecting a crypto trading bot, there are several key factors to consider. Firstly, you need to assess the bot's compatibility with your chosen exchange and whether it supports the cryptocurrencies you're interested in trading. Secondly, it's important to evaluate the bot's performance history and track record to determine its reliability and profitability. Additionally, you should consider the bot's user-friendliness and ease of customization, as well as the level of customer support available. Finally, it's crucial to ensure that the bot is secure and employs robust security measures to protect your funds.
